It was announced today that more actors have joined the fan-favorite Hulu series, Only Murders in the Building. Actors Richard Kind, Daphne Rubin-Vega, Catherine Cohen, and Jin Ha have been cast in the upcoming fouth season, all in recurring roles. They join the previously announced new cast members Molly Shannon, Eva Longoria, Eugene Levy, Zach Galifianakis, Desmin Borges, Siena Werber and Lilian Rebelo.
